Underwater Nursery Theme: 5 Ways to Decorate Fast

Not everyone has scads of money to spend on nursery décor and if you find yourself short on time, here are a few ways to get an awesome underwater nursery theme in no time at all. An underwater nursery theme is a lot of fun to create and very simple to do. It can be quite relaxing and grow with your baby, too. So, just how do you get the perfect underwater baby room? Here are some tips.1. Underwater wallpaper borders. These come ready to put up. You just need to measure the room and make sure you get it even, then follow the directions to run the fish border around the room!2. Paint in blues. If you are using a wallpaper border, you can paint the top half of the room light blue, while the lower half is darker. This creates the illusion of water. If you want to be a bit more complicated without the border, split the walls into three parts and paint the lightest blue at the top, the darkest at the bottom.3. Wall decals. These let you create an instant underwater theme! Just peel and stick fish sticker around the underwater nursery for a fun look. You’ll find that there are cartoon fish, as well as more realistic ones. 4. Change the bedding. The crib will likely be the focal point for your underwater nursery theme, so get a baby blanket that fits the theme. You can also get entire underwater theme sets, with crib sheets, bumpers, etc. but the real decoration is the quilt. 5. Add some prints. You can cute magazine pictures of marine life out and laminate them to hang around the room, or you can buy actual paintings and framed photos to decorate the room. Just make sure they are out of reach once your little one grows a bit. An underwater nursery theme is the perfect way to welcome your baby and it really doesn’t have to be too expensive or difficult to do.

Baby Nursery Decoration – Don’t Forget These Essential Considerations

If you’re having trouble deciding on your baby nursery decoration, the first thing to do is just step back, relax, and decide to have fun with it. It doesn’t have to be a stressful or hard endeavor, and is quite fun for most expectant parents if they allow themselves enough time in advance of the baby’s arrival.

Deciding On the Color Scheme
The first step is to just decide what colors to use. There are so many to choose from and the baby nursery colors are one of the best ways to set the mood for the nursery. You may be aware that pink for girls and blue for boys have historically been the default colors, but that’s not the case anymore. Today, expectant parents have way more freedom when choosing colors, patterns, fabrics, accessories and much more. It’s a good idea to choose neutral tones accented with brighter colors. Don’t go overboard with the color scheme though since overstimulation for babies needs to be avoided in the first year or so. You want to use soothing colors during the time your child is being introduced to the world. We suggest calming, cool colors such as soft blues, purples, greens, etc. Bold colors should only be used sparingly.
